New 2% Monthly Fine Introduced for Failure to Settle Outstanding Non-Tax State Revenue Within the Forest Plant Seeding Sector

In 2014, the Minister of Forestry (“ Minister ”) introduced Regulation No. P.72/MENHUT-II/2014 (“ Regulation 72/2014 ”) on Procedures for the Imposition, Collection and Deposit of Non-Tax State Revenue (Penerimaan Negara Bukan Pajak– “ PNBP ”) at the Ministry of Forestry as Derived from Forest Plant Seeding Activities. Broadly speaking, Regulation 72/2014 featured a set of provisions that specifically addressed the imposition, collection and deposit of PNBP for the forest plant seeding activities (perbenihan) sector. These activities were classified into several categories (e.g. licensing fees and seed certification) that specifically related to forest plant seeds (“ Seeds ”) (benih) and forest plant seedlings (“ Seedlings ”) (bibit).
